Xata
Xata is a serverless Postgres platform designed for modern development and agentic workloads, offering instant database branching with copy-on-write storage so teams can clone any Postgres database in under one second. The platform provides a managed REST API, CLI, TypeScript and Python SDKs, and a WebSocket wire-protocol proxy for direct Postgres connections. Xata supports schema migrations, built-in PII anonymization, and scale-to-zero compute, with deployment options spanning Xata Cloud (SaaS), BYOC, and open-source self-hosted. An open-source AI agent (Xata Agent) monitors and optimizes PostgreSQL performance with MCP server extensibility.

Xata API Keys API
Operations for managing API keys, including creation, listing, and deletion
Xata Billing API
Internal organization billing operations
Xata Branches API
Operations for managing database branches within projects, including creation, configuration, and deletion
Xata Gateway API
PostgreSQL connectivity via HTTP SQL, WebSocket wire protocol proxy, and native wire protocol.
Xata GitHub App API
Operations for managing GitHub App installation mappings
Xata Logs API
Operations for retrieving log entries for a branch
Xata Marketplace API
Operations for linking user accounts to cloud marketplace subscriptions
Xata Metrics API
Operations for retrieving observability metrics for a branch
Xata Organizations API
Operations for creating, retrieving, updating, and deleting organizations
Xata Projects API
Operations for creating, retrieving, updating, and deleting projects within an organization
